What is an Inverter Heat Pump?

Aninverterheat pumpis a type of heating and cooling system that uses an inverter-driven compressor to more efficiently regulate temperature. Unlike traditional systems that cycle on and off at full power, an inverter heat pump can adjust its compressor speed based on demand.

Why make the Change to an Inverter?

Think of a regular heat pump like a basic on/off light switch. It either runs at full power or is completely off. It turns on when the temperature drops or rises beyond a set point, then shuts off once the target is reached. This on-and-off cycling is effective, but it can lead to:

 

  • Temperature Swings:You might feel moments of being too hot or too cold as the system cycles.
  • Higher Energy Bills:Each time it starts up, it draws a lot of power, like when you accelerate quickly in a car.
  • More Wear & Tear:The constant starting and stopping can put more stress on the components, potentially shortening the lifespan of the unit.
  • Noisier Operation:You’ll hear it turn on and off more distinctly.

 

Now, think of aninverter heat pumplike a dimmer switch for your lights. Instead of just being fully on or off, it adjusts the level of power based on how much heating or cooling is needed. It can modulate its output continuously, using just enough energy to maintain comfort efficiently.

  • Precise Temperature Control:Inverter heat pumps constantly monitor your home’s temperature and adjusts its output to match the exact heating or cooling needed. It can run at a low, gentle speed to maintain your desired temperature, making tiny adjustments as needed – Meaning no more uncomfortable temperature swings
  • More Energy Efficient:Inverter systems can be up to 30–50% more efficient than fixed-speed (on/off) systems. Because it’s not constantly cycling on and off at full blast, it uses much less energy overall. It’s like gently cruising on the highway instead of constantly stopping and starting in traffic. This means lower energy bills for you.
  • Quieter Operation:Because they run at lower speeds for longer periods, they produce less noise than traditional HVAC systems.
  • Works in Cold Climates:Modern inverter heat pumps can operate in sub-freezing temperatures, often down to -5°F (-20°C) or lower (depending on the model).
  • Lower Operating Costs:The energy savings from inverter technology typically lead to lower utility bills over time. Initial costs may be higher, but payback through efficiency can occur within a few years.
  • Longer Lifespan:Since they avoid the wear and tear caused by frequent starts and stops, inverter compressors typically last longer than standard ones.
  • Faster Heating & Cooling:The system can ramp up quickly to reach the desired temperature, then slow down to maintain it efficiently.
